È possibile riavviare un dispositivo Samba NAS (Cisco / Linksys NSS4000) utilizzando telnet?


0

Ho un NAS Samba, Cisco / Linksys NSS4000 , a cui non riesco a collegarmi utilizzando i percorsi UNC o la mappatura delle unità e non riesco ad accedere all'applicazione Web integrata. Ma posso eseguire il ping del dispositivo tramite il suo indirizzo IP e telnet. È possibile riavviare il dispositivo tramite telnet?

Ho provato porte 80, 443, 139, ed 8888e posso telnet con successo in ciascuno. O almeno, non ricevo errori.

Risposte:


0

Se è possibile SSH (porta 22 normalmente), è possibile riavviare con reboot now


Finora questa è l'unica porta che ho provato a cui non posso telnet.
Brian

0

Ho un NAS Samba a cui non riesco a collegarmi usando percorsi UNC o mappatura di unità e non riesco ad accedere all'applicazione web integrata. Ma posso eseguire il ping del dispositivo tramite il suo indirizzo IP e telnet. È possibile riavviare il dispositivo tramite telnet?

In generale, quello che stai descrivendo come "NAS Samba" è semplicemente una scatola Linux di qualche tipo che esegue un sistema operativo minimo ottimizzato per essere una condivisione Samba. Quindi su un box Linux puoi riavviare il sistema usando il seguente comando:

sudo shutdown -r now

O forse usa lo stesso comando, ma senza sudoquesto:

shutdown -r now

Ma su alcuni sistemi embedded, come quelli che usano BusyBox, l'uso di questo comando funzionerebbe:

system reboot

Ma senza conoscere l'esatta marca / modello del NAS in questione, è difficile dire quale dovrebbe essere il comando esatto.

Inoltre, è necessario disporre di una sessione console / terminale sul dispositivo per eseguire effettivamente tali comandi. Se si sta cercando di telnet in 80, 443, 139e 8888e l'esecuzione di comandi, che non funzionerà. Quando telnet a porte del genere, stai semplicemente effettuando una connessione di protocollo a qualunque servizio possa essere in esecuzione su quella porta. E se nessuno di loro sono in esecuzione una sessione di console / terminale i comandi non funzioneranno in quanto i porti 80, 443e 8888sono tutte le porte servizi web e la porta 139è semplicemente una porta NetBIOS.


Post originale aggiornato per dire che è un NSS4000.
Brian,

1
I comandi più basilari sono haltereboot . Sono disponibili in diversi gusti ma sono sempre presenti su qualsiasi sistema Linux o UNIX.
Daniel B,

Non penso che questi comandi vengano effettivamente passati. Ho provato ogni variante di riavvio che mi viene in mente durante la sessione Telnet, su varie porte.
Brian

@ Brian Se si sta cercando di telnet in 80, 443, 139e 8888e l'esecuzione di comandi, che non funzionerà. Quando telnet a porte del genere, stai semplicemente effettuando una connessione di protocollo a qualunque servizio possa essere in esecuzione su quella porta. E se nessuno di loro sono in esecuzione una sessione di console / terminale i comandi non funzioneranno in quanto i porti 80, 443e 8888sono tutte le porte servizi web e la porta 139è semplicemente una porta NetBIOS.
Jake Gould

OK, quindi potrebbe non essere possibile dopo tutto. Il dispositivo è piuttosto bloccato, quindi non credo che sarò in grado di accedere al terminale.
Brian
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.